To estimate how much of each chemical you will need, the first step is to determine the volume of your pool. The following form represents an easy method to calculate pool volume. Rectangular Pools: Length x Width x Average Depth x 7.5 = Total Gallons. ft. Determine how many gallons of water is in your pool. (Pool’s length x Pool’s width x Pool’s average depth x 7.5) Figure out the pump’s gallon per minute (GPM) This information is typically listed on the pump label. Use Chlorine Tablets. The best way to obtain a constant, consistent chlorine level in the pool is to use 1″ tablets or 3″ tablets in a floating chlorinator, aka chlorine floater. Most inflatable pools need just half of one 3″ tablet per week, or several 1″ tabs at a time, replaced promptly when they dissolve. 1. Place Tab (s) In Feeder, Floater or Skimmer. Follow the on-pack instructions according to your pool size. Do not add tabs directly to the pool as this could damage surfaces. 2. Repeat Weekly. For best results, replace your tab every week or as often as needed to maintain a chlorine residual of 1-4 ppm.
